		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Hi Lisa &#8211;</p>
<p>The short answer: nope, absolutely not.</p>
<p>The slightly longer answer: you cannot buy milk that means the animal wasn&#8217;t abused in any way because even on the happiest of organic farms (which mostly exist only in people&#8217;s imagination), dairy cows still need to be forcibly impregnated, their babies still have to be taken from them, many of their babies become veal, and the dairy cows themselves will be killed at a very early age once they&#8217;re &#8220;spent.&#8221;</p>
<p>So, there you go.  There is no such thing as &#8220;humane&#8221; milk, eggs, or meat because they all come from the exploitation of animals and all of the animals die early and violently.</p>
